TEHRAN, June 18 -- The Iranian freestyle wrestlers finished in first place at the Junior Asian Wrestling Championships on Sunday.
The Iranian team won three gold medals, two silvers and two bronzes, claiming the title with 69 points, according to Tehran Times daily.
Uzbekistan finished in second place with 67 points and Kazakhstan came third with 57 points.
Also, Iran put in impressive performances by claiming the Greco-Roman title on Saturday.
The young Iranian wrestlers notched 71 points to stand atop the podium by a wide margin in the team division of the tournament.
The Junior Asian Wrestling Championships kicked off in the Taichung city of China's Taiwan Province on June 15, and were wrapped up on June 18, 2017.
The tournament brought together dozens of male and female freestyle and Greco-Roman wrestlers from various Asian countries and regions, including China, Chinese Taipei, India, Iran,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, South Korea and Uzbekistan.
